Select Brand:

Show All


£28.04

Dispatch on next business day

£672.00

Dispatch on next business day

£50.77

Dispatch on next business day

£122.70

Dispatch on next business day

£58.49

Dispatch on next business day

£89.20

Dispatch on next business day

£88.76

Dispatch on next business day

£45.87

Dispatch on next business day

£2.10

Dispatch on next business day